Key legal question
Whether the permit for a second residence had to be annulled under Articles 75b and 197 No. 9 Constitution.
Extracted holding
Yes. The permit was issued after the constitutional provisions entered into force, the project was an admitted second residence, and the commune already exceeded the 20% threshold.
Extracted reasoning
The court relied on its case law that Article 75b Constitution is directly applicable to permits issued after 11 March 2012 and that permits issued before 1 January 2013 are annulable, while later permits are null. As the present permit was issued after entry into force, it had to be annulled.
